|  | def WipeChromeData(device, options): | 
|  | """Wipes chrome specific data from device | 
|  |  | 
|  | (1) uninstall any app whose name matches *chrom*, except | 
|  | com.android.chrome, which is the chrome stable package. Doing so also | 
|  | removes the corresponding dirs under /data/data/ and /data/app/ | 
|  | (2) remove any dir under /data/app-lib/ whose name matches *chrom* | 
|  | (3) remove any files under /data/tombstones/ whose name matches "tombstone*" | 
|  | (4) remove /data/local.prop if there is any | 
|  | (5) remove /data/local/chrome-command-line if there is any | 
|  | (6) remove anything under /data/local/.config/ if the dir exists | 
|  | (this is telemetry related) | 
|  | (7) remove anything under /data/local/tmp/ | 
|  |  | 
|  | Arguments: | 
|  | device: the device to wipe | 
|  | """ | 
|  | if options.skip_wipe: | 
|  | return | 
|  |  | 
|  | try: | 
|  | if device.IsUserBuild(): | 
|  | _UninstallIfMatch(device, _CHROME_PACKAGE_REGEX, | 
|  | constants.PACKAGE_INFO['chrome_stable'].package) | 
|  | device.RunShellCommand('rm -rf %s/*' % device.GetExternalStoragePath(), | 
|  | check_return=True) | 
|  | device.RunShellCommand('rm -rf /data/local/tmp/*', check_return=True) | 
|  | else: | 
|  | device.EnableRoot() | 
|  | _UninstallIfMatch(device, _CHROME_PACKAGE_REGEX, | 
|  | constants.PACKAGE_INFO['chrome_stable'].package) | 
|  | _WipeUnderDirIfMatch(device, '/data/app-lib/', _CHROME_PACKAGE_REGEX) | 
|  | _WipeUnderDirIfMatch(device, '/data/tombstones/', _TOMBSTONE_REGEX) | 
|  |  | 
|  | _WipeFileOrDir(device, '/data/local.prop') | 
|  | _WipeFileOrDir(device, '/data/local/chrome-command-line') | 
|  | _WipeFileOrDir(device, '/data/local/.config/') | 
|  | _WipeFileOrDir(device, '/data/local/tmp/') | 
|  | device.RunShellCommand('rm -rf %s/*' % device.GetExternalStoragePath(), | 
|  | check_return=True) | 
|  | except device_errors.CommandFailedError: | 
|  | logging.exception('Possible failure while wiping the device. ' | 
|  | 'Attempting to continue.') |

|  | def WipeDevice(device, options): | 
|  | """Wipes data from device, keeping only the adb_keys for authorization. | 
|  |  | 
|  | After wiping data on a device that has been authorized, adb can still | 
|  | communicate with the device, but after reboot the device will need to be | 
|  | re-authorized because the adb keys file is stored in /data/misc/adb/. | 
|  | Thus, adb_keys file is rewritten so the device does not need to be | 
|  | re-authorized. | 
|  |  | 
|  | Arguments: | 
|  | device: the device to wipe | 
|  | """ | 
|  | if options.skip_wipe: | 
|  | return | 
|  |  | 
|  | try: | 
|  | device.EnableRoot() | 
|  | device_authorized = device.FileExists(constants.ADB_KEYS_FILE) | 
|  | if device_authorized: | 
|  | adb_keys = device.ReadFile(constants.ADB_KEYS_FILE, | 
|  | as_root=True).splitlines() | 
|  | device.RunShellCommand(['wipe', 'data'], | 
|  | as_root=True, check_return=True) | 
|  | device.adb.WaitForDevice() | 
|  |  | 
|  | if device_authorized: | 
|  | adb_keys_set = set(adb_keys) | 
|  | for adb_key_file in options.adb_key_files or []: | 
|  | try: | 
|  | with open(adb_key_file, 'r') as f: | 
|  | adb_public_keys = f.readlines() | 
|  | adb_keys_set.update(adb_public_keys) | 
|  | except IOError: | 
|  | logging.warning('Unable to find adb keys file %s.', adb_key_file) | 
|  | _WriteAdbKeysFile(device, '\n'.join(adb_keys_set)) | 
|  | except device_errors.CommandFailedError: | 
|  | logging.exception('Possible failure while wiping the device. ' | 
|  | 'Attempting to continue.') | 
|  |  | 
|  |  | 
|  | def _WriteAdbKeysFile(device, adb_keys_string): | 
|  | dir_path = posixpath.dirname(constants.ADB_KEYS_FILE) | 
|  | device.RunShellCommand(['mkdir', '-p', dir_path], | 
|  | as_root=True, check_return=True) | 
|  | device.RunShellCommand(['restorecon', dir_path], | 
|  | as_root=True, check_return=True) | 
|  | device.WriteFile(constants.ADB_KEYS_FILE, adb_keys_string, as_root=True) | 
|  | device.RunShellCommand(['restorecon', constants.ADB_KEYS_FILE], | 
|  | as_root=True, check_return=True) |
